Porsche 911 Carrera RS America

(1993 model)

Brief specs of 1993 Porsche 911 Carrera RS America

2-door 2+2-seater fixed-head coupé, petrol (gasoline) 6-cylinder 12-valve flat (horizontally opposed, boxer) engine, SOHC (single overhead camshaft), 3600 cm3 / 219.7 cu in / 219.7 cu in, 184.2 kW / 247.0 hp / 247.0 hp @ 6100 rpm / 6100 rpm / 6100 rpm, 309.0 N·m / 227.9 lb·ft / 227.9 lb·ft @ 4800 rpm / 4800 rpm / 4800 rpm, manual 5-speed transmission, rear wheel drive, 253 km/h / 157 mph / 157 mph top speed
